Subject: Quickstore 4.2 — bloom filter now fronts the KV layer

Plugin authors: starting with this release, Quickstore places a bloom filter ahead of the key-value store. Negative lookups return faster; false positives fall through safely. No API changes are required on your side. Verify your plugin against the staging build referenced below.

session token of fahif-tadup = htk3_9c7

Welcome to the Quillseek plugin program. You may notice the autocomplete index rebuilds slowly on first sync; this is expected while the Tindervale shard warms its cache. Plugins should tolerate up to 40 seconds of stale suggestions and must not retry aggressively. To register your plugin sandbox and restore it after resets, use the recovery passphrase provided below.

strongbox words: gilok-druion-briath-wendor-briion-prawyn-fenion-oliir-casdor-holius-briius-gilath-gilael-pelys

### Queue-Depth Autoscaler: Manual Override

If the Cranewatch autoscaler stops responding to backlog growth on the Ferryline ingest queue, support can trigger a manual scale event. First confirm queue depth exceeds 5,000 via the dashboard, then call the scaler's /force-scale endpoint with the desired replica count (max 40). Scale-downs are automatic; never force them manually. The endpoint requires authentication against the internal orchestration service with the key below.

gateway credential: kto15_BFZGGy3oznOSd45

Handover note — Crumbwheel order cutoffs.

Welcome aboard. The bakery cutoff rule in Crumbwheel closes same-day orders at 14:00 local to each storefront, not UTC — this has bitten us twice. Holiday overrides live in the calendar service and take precedence silently, so always check there first when a cutoff looks wrong. To unlock the calendar service's admin console after a restart, enter the recovery passphrase below.

vault phrase of bagap-bahaf = silion-pelox-sorox-casdor-quenwyn-fraax-eliox-praael-kelion-quenvan-kasox-rusael-norius-belvan